The United States' efforts to secure strategic minerals from the Democratic Republic of Congo are being met with significant challenges. Despite signing a minerals pact, conflicts, licensing issues, and complex compliance requirements are slowing progress. A recently shared 44-project shortlist exemplifies Washington's ambitions but underscores the substantial hurdles ahead.

According to industry insiders, several projects on this list are hampered by political tensions and permitting disputes, making swift mining deals unlikely. A U.S. diplomat indicated that Kinshasa is strategically delaying agreements to maintain leverage over the U.S., demanding more pressure on the M23 rebel group. However, the backdrop of violence and instability continues to complicate the situation.

For now, the U.S. remains focused on improving security and governance as major prerequisites for investment. As Zambia progresses with infrastructure development in the Manono region, U.S.-backed firms face burdensome compliance checks, contrasting sharply with the faster pace of Chinese operators. The U.S. hopes that its deeper involvement will lead to significant political and security benefits, yet competing with China's established presence remains a formidable challenge.
